Launching TetherFi from quick settings tile hotspot configuration is missing. #218

Closed alexusa2002 closed 11 months ago

alexusa2002 commented 1 year ago

I'm trying to automate when TetherFi launches by using Tasker. The tile under quick settings works very well for automation, but once the app is launched the hotspot configuration is blank. For example, Hotspot Name will say "NO NAME", Password will say "NO PASSWORD", and Proxy/URL will say "NO HOST". Proxy port still shows 8228. If I hit refresh hotspot the configuration eventually shows up, but this defeats the purpose of automating. I'm running Android 13. Thank you!

I'm using TetherFi to share my phone's Internet connection with the Android based radio unit in my car. With Tasker I can create an automation that launches TetherFi when my phone connects with the radio's Bluetooth. Launching the main TetherFi app I still have to manually press "Start TetherFi Hotspot", but Tasker allows me to use the TetherFi quicklaunch tile instead. With the tile I don't have to press "Start TetherFi Hotspot", which allows to automate launching the hotspot without any user interaction.

Removing Tasker from this scenario, I still have the same problem. Most of the time when I manually launch TetherFi from the quick settings tile, the hotspot configuration is not present. The hotspot will start, but not the proxy. Also, the configuration settings are not set. I have to press refresh hotspot. I'm attaching a screenshot.
